Hiking around Forstwald, a district of Krefeld, offers a serene forest environment known as the "green lung" of the city. The area is characterized by a lush canopy of deciduous trees, including oak, beech, and birch. It features a predominantly flat terrain with well-maintained paths, making the hiking trails around Forstwald accessible for various skill levels. This gentle topography ensures peaceful walks amidst nature.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the general difficulty of hiking trails in Forstwald?

The hiking trails in Forstwald are predominantly flat with well-maintained paths, making them accessible for a wide range of skill levels. While there are over 640 easy routes, you'll also find over 500 moderate and around 50 more challenging options, ensuring there's something for everyone.

Are there family-friendly hiking options in Forstwald?

Yes, Forstwald is very suitable for families. The gentle topography and well-maintained paths make for peaceful walks amidst nature. An excellent option for a gentle outing is the Himmelthal Monastery – Rücker Jesuitenberg Vineyards loop from Forstwald, which is an easy 4.5 km (2.8 miles) path.

Can I hike with my dog in Forstwald?

Forstwald's serene forest environment is generally welcoming for dogs. The area is characterized by lush deciduous trees and open paths, providing a pleasant setting for you and your canine companion. Always ensure your dog is under control and respect local wildlife.

How can I get to the hiking trails in Forstwald, and is parking available?

Forstwald is easily accessible. The area benefits from its proximity to the Forstwald train station, making it convenient for those using public transport. Additionally, there is available parking for hikers who prefer to drive to the trailheads.

When is the best time of year to go hiking in Forstwald?

Forstwald offers a beautiful hiking experience throughout many seasons. During spring and summer, the forest floor is often carpeted with vibrant ferns and wildflowers, and the lush canopy provides ample shade. Autumn brings a stunning display of colors from the deciduous trees. The predominantly flat terrain makes it enjoyable even in milder winter conditions.

What kind of natural features and wildlife can I expect to see in Forstwald?

Forstwald is known for its serene forest environment, often called the 'green lung' of Krefeld. You'll be surrounded by a lush canopy of oak, beech, and birch trees. The forest is also a haven for local wildlife; you might spot deer, foxes, and a variety of bird species, including woodpeckers, owls, and songbirds.
